DNA Solutions migrates critical Oracle and SAP environments to modern architectures without disrupting ongoing operations. Our engineering teams validate the data row by row and remove technical debt across high-volume transaction pipelines.
Trusted by Europe's leading organizations
High-volume environments cannot absorb the operational risk of a big-bang migration. DNA Solutions runs the legacy and target systems in parallel, synchronizing databases through Change Data Capture, and validates the output row by row before any switchover. Our senior team has 20+ years of engineering experience across Oracle, SAP, and enterprise cloud platforms.
DNA Solutions designs technology that lands on your bottom line. European enterprises trust us with extreme data volumes and critical financial pipelines.
See client resultsDNA Solutions built and maintains a Deloitte-audited billing platform processing €300M in audited transactions every month.
By optimizing software licensing fees for a major European organization, DNA Solutions delivered over €1M in yearly cost savings.
A senior team of engineers and consultants across Europe.
T-Systems, Satellic, European Commission: our longest engagements last because we deliver.
Legacy debt sits at the database and the application level. We work both, with continuity and vendor independence as fixed constraints.
We start by auditing large Oracle estates to map the schema, the dependencies and the workloads that carry the highest licensing cost. We then move those workloads onto PostgreSQL or cloud-managed databases, using Change Data Capture to keep source and target synchronized throughout the transition. The migration stays reversible until you are ready to switch over, so the legacy system remains the source of truth until the new platform has proven itself on your real data.
We run the legacy and target systems concurrently rather than switching over in a single step. Automated scripts compare the outputs of both systems row by row and confirm full reconciliation at every cycle, so any discrepancy surfaces before it reaches production. A client segment is moved permanently to the new architecture only once its results match the legacy output. This keeps transaction-critical operations available throughout the migration and removes the risk of a hard cutover.
We decouple tightly bound monolithic applications into independent services along clear domain boundaries. Each service owns its data and its deployment cycle, so your teams can scale individual components against their real load and ship targeted updates without triggering system-wide regressions. We sequence the decoupling so the application keeps running at every step, extracting one bounded context at a time rather than rewriting the platform in one pass. The result is a system that is easier to operate, test and extend.
Legacy estates often carry proprietary database and middleware licences that no longer match actual usage. The audit quantifies the current licensing footprint and identifies workloads that can move to open-source or cloud-managed databases without functional loss. Where it makes sense, we map those workloads onto PostgreSQL or a managed cloud database to exit licensing costs entirely rather than carrying them into the new platform. Savings depend on the existing footprint, so we size them during the audit phase before committing to a target architecture.
DNA Solutions modernizes critical Oracle and SAP environments for high-volume enterprises. From database migration to application decoupling, we remove technical debt while keeping operations running.
What we buildWe audit large Oracle estates and identify reducible licensing costs. We map these workloads onto PostgreSQL or cloud-managed databases, using Change Data Capture for continuous synchronization throughout the transition.
We run the legacy and target systems concurrently. Automated scripts validate the outputs row by row and confirm full reconciliation before any client segment is permanently moved to the new architecture.
We decouple tightly bound monolithic applications into independent services. This lets enterprises scale individual components and deploy targeted updates without triggering system-wide regressions.
Telecom and tolling run transaction-critical systems that cannot stop. The modernization discipline holds across both; the events and regulations around it do not.
OSS/BSS, billing, and charging systems modernized for European telecom operators, with continuity on critical transaction pipelines.
Migration of toll and road-charging databases to modern architectures, with parallel running to keep collection systems available during switchover.
How we migrate and decouple critical systems for European enterprises without disrupting operations.
A scalable microservices architecture that rates high volumes of GPS events and applies multi-country tax rules to generate unified invoices.
Rating pipeline, multi-country
A single payment gateway unifying transactions across a multi-product platform, with reconciliation built in.
One gateway, every productSenior decision-makers on the infrastructure, tolling and financial platforms DNA Solutions has modernized.
"DNA works with us to deliver digital systems at scale so that we can serve our customers digitally. They are both reactive to requests and proactive with ideas and proposals."
"The quality of the people I worked with and the seriousness of the project management stood out. DNA built a backend and app for a highway toll system, and the human side of the company is truly remarkable."
"I appreciated the collaborative spirit and the effort to deliver a reliable solution within a reasonable budget. The step-by-step approach with a demo before deployment made all the difference."
The questions that matter before touching a transaction-critical system.
DNA Solutions never runs a big-bang cutover. We keep the legacy and target systems running in parallel and use Change Data Capture to keep the two databases synchronized while both stay available to your operations. At every billing or processing cycle, automated scripts compare the outputs of both systems row by row and confirm full reconciliation, so any discrepancy is caught before it can affect production. A client segment is migrated permanently only once the target system matches the legacy output to the cent. Because the legacy system remains the source of truth until that point, the migration stays fully reversible. This is how we keep transaction-critical environments available throughout the transition instead of betting everything on a single switchover window.
DNA Solutions focuses on critical Oracle and SAP environments, including billing, charging, and high-volume data pipelines where downtime is not an option. On the database side, we map Oracle estates onto PostgreSQL or cloud-managed databases and use Change Data Capture for continuous synchronization during the move. On the application side, we decouple monolithic systems into independent services where doing so reduces operational risk and lets your teams deploy components separately. We also modernize the integration layer between these systems and the surrounding ERP and reporting stack. Our senior team brings 20+ years of engineering experience across these platforms, applied on billing, charging and data infrastructure for European operators, so the modernization path we propose is grounded in systems we have run in production.
It often can. In one engagement, DNA Solutions removed over €1M in yearly software licensing fees for a European enterprise client by modernizing legacy infrastructure. The work starts with an audit that maps the existing estate, quantifies the current licensing footprint and flags the workloads that carry the most cost without depending on proprietary features. We then identify which of those workloads can move to open-source or cloud-managed databases, typically PostgreSQL or a managed cloud database, without functional loss. Each candidate is migrated under the same parallel-running and reconciliation discipline we apply everywhere, so cost reduction never comes at the expense of data integrity. Because savings depend entirely on your current footprint, we size them during the audit phase and present them before any commitment, rather than promising a figure up front.
We migrate in stages, by client segment or workload, never in a single big-bang cutover. The sequence is planned during the audit so the lowest-risk workloads move first and the team builds confidence on real data before touching the most critical flows. Each stage is validated and reconciled against the legacy system, output by output, before it is moved permanently. Because the legacy and target systems run in parallel during this window, the impact of any issue is contained to the segment being migrated, and a rollback affects only that segment. For a full enterprise migration from a legacy Oracle or SAP estate, expect the program to span several months of phased moves rather than a single release. This keeps high-volume, transaction-critical environments available throughout the migration cycle.